Ako reštartovať Linux

Ako Restartovat Linux



Keď pracujete ako správca systému v systéme Linux, väčšina konfigurácií vyžaduje reštart systému. Navyše, hlavné aktualizácie servera, systémové knižnice a aktualizácie jadra tiež vyžadujú reštart systému.

Reštartovanie počítača so systémom Linux je bezpečný proces ukončenia systémových programov bez poškodenia údajov. Ak však reštartujete systém bez uloženia potrebných údajov, môžete ich stratiť alebo ich poškodiť. Takže vykonajte funkciu reštartu, keď nie je šanca na poškodenie údajov a čo stratiť.







Ako reštartovať Linux

V distribúciách Linuxu máme rôzne spôsoby reštartovania/reštartu systému vrátane viacerých nástrojov príkazového riadka a grafického používateľského rozhrania.



Reštartujte systém Linux pomocou nástrojov príkazového riadka

Táto časť bude diskutovať o všetkých populárnych nástrojoch, ktoré pomáhajú reštartovať systém Linux; poďme o nich diskutovať:



  1. reštartujte príkaz
  2. príkaz systemctl
  3. príkaz na vypnutie
  4. Príkaz init

Reštartujte systém Linux pomocou príkazu reboot

The reštartovať nástroj príkazového riadka je skratka a populárny nástroj na reštartovanie systému bez akýchkoľvek prekážok. Vykonajte príkaz reboot s oprávneniami sudo, aby ste vykonali funkciu reštartu ako správca:





sudo reštartovať



Pre okamžitý proces môžeme použiť aj -f parameter na vynútené reštartovanie systému bez akéhokoľvek oneskorenia:

sudo reštartovať -f

Alebo môžete spustiť príkaz reboot s cestou:

/ sbin / reštartovať

Reštartujte systém Linux pomocou príkazu systemctl

Nástroj príkazového riadka systemctl v systéme Linux monitoruje a konfiguruje systémové služby systému Linux, keď fungujú. Používateľ môže povoliť, spustiť, zastaviť a vypnúť akúkoľvek službu pomocou príkazu systemctl. Nielen to, ale tento príkaz funguje ako multitaskingový nástroj, ktorý sa používa aj na reštartovanie počítača so systémom Linux.

Ak chcete vykonať úlohu reštartu, zadajte do terminálu uvedený príkaz systemctl:

sudo reštart systemctl

Reštartujte systém firmvéru pomocou príkazu systemctl

Náš počítač je možné reštartovať do rozhrania BIOS pomocou príkazu systemctl. Tento príkaz však nebude fungovať na všetkých systémoch, okrem moderných zariadení, serverov a desktopov.

sudo reštart systemctl --firmware-setup

Reštartujte systém Linux pomocou príkazu shutdown

Pomôcka príkazového riadka vypnutia sa používa na bezpečné vypnutie operačného systému Linux. Nielen to, ale tiež umožňuje zastaviť (obmedziť OS na zastavenie vykonávania funkcií) a reštartovať stroj.

Spustite ktorýkoľvek z uvedených príkazov na vypnutie v termináli a reštartujte počítač so systémom Linux:

Syntax na reštartovanie počítača pomocou príkazového nástroja vypnutia je nasledovná:

sudo vypnúť -r < Čas >

Vo vyššie uvedenej syntaxi je -r argument spúšťa funkciu reštartu a môžete tiež určiť čas, do ktorého sa má úloha vykonať.

Využime vyššie uvedenú syntax priradením času a spustením nasledujúceho príkazu v termináli:

sudo vypnúť -r + 3

Vo vyššie uvedenom príkaze:

vypnúť: Príkaz Linux používaný na vypnutie alebo reštartovanie počítača so systémom Linux.

-r: Požiada systém Linux o reštart.

+3: Hovorí počítaču so systémom Linux, aby počkal 3 minúty a potom sa reštartoval.

Pre proces okamžitého reštartu môžete jednoducho spustiť nasledujúci príkaz:

vypnúť -r teraz

Alebo môžete tiež priradiť úplnú cestu, ako je uvedené nižšie:

/ sbin / vypnúť -r teraz

Ak chcete reštartovať systém v konkrétnom čase, formát by bol hh:mm, kde musíte uviesť hodiny a minúty; Páči sa mi to:

sudo vypnúť -r +02: 30

Príkaz shutdown tiež umožňuje zrušenie plánovaného procesu reštartu odovzdaním parametra -c:

vypnúť -c

Reštartujte systém Linux pomocou príkazu „init / telinit“.

Skratka z teplo príkazový nástroj v Linuxe je inicializácia; ako názov popisuje, tento príkaz pomáha inicializovať všetky procesy na pozadí a ovládať ich vždy, keď sa systém spustí.

Môžeme tiež použiť príkazový nástroj init na reštartovanie počítača Linux s úrovňou spustenia 6; ktorý je nastavený na reštartovanie systému v procese na pozadí:

teplo 6

S úplnou cestou by príkaz bol:

/ sbin / teplo 6

Proces reštartu v systéme Linux možno vykonať aj pomocou telini príkaz, ktorý sa používa na riadenie init operácií alebo môžeme povedať front-end procesov init.

Spustite príkaz telinit jeho odoslaním na úroveň spustenia 6, aby ste reštartovali počítač:

sudo telini 6

Reštartujte server Linux na diaľku

Ak chcete vzdialene reštartovať server Linux, musíme sa prihlásiť cez SSH ako užívateľ root a postupovať podľa uvedenej syntaxe:

ssh koreň @ remote-server.com / sbin / reštartovať

Alebo pre akciu okamžitého reštartu použite syntax:

ssh koreň @ vzdialený server / sbin / reštartovať -r teraz\

Nahraďte vzdialený server IP adresou servera, ktorý chcete reštartovať, napríklad:

ssh koreň @ 192.168.1.1 / sbin / reštartovať

Ďalšie:

Keď systém vykoná operácie odhlásenia alebo prihlásenia, uloží záznam do /var/logwtmp súbor. Ak chcete získať záznam o odhlásení z tohto súboru, použite príkaz:

posledný reštartovať

Reštartujte systém Linux cez grafické používateľské rozhranie

Najjednoduchší spôsob reštartovania počítača so systémom Linux je pomocou GUI. Otvorte pracovnú plochu Linuxu (vykonávam to na Ubuntu 22.04) a prejdite kurzorom na tlačidlo napájania:

Tam kliknite na Vypnúť/odhlásiť sa a vyberte Reštart z ďalej zobrazených možností:

Zobrazí sa vyskakovacie okno na potvrdenie procesu reštartovania, kliknite na Reštart tlačidlo:

Záver

Operácia reštartu sa vyžaduje, keď používateľ konfiguruje systémový server a/alebo vykonáva akcie kompilácie servera. Niektoré z knižníc jadra tiež vyžadujú reštartovanie systému počas aktualizácie. Násilné reštarty však môžu viesť aj k poškodeniu systémových súborov alebo strate potrebných neuložených údajov.

V tejto príručke sme vykonali operácie reštartu pomocou niekoľkých nástrojov príkazového riadka. Populárne nástroje príkazového riadka, ktoré pomáhajú reštartovať systém Linux, sú príkazy reštart, systemctl, init a shutdown. Ďalším jednoduchým spôsobom vykonania funkcie reštartu je použitie grafického používateľského rozhrania.